Phinite

Were developing tech to feed the world. The world is running out of phosphorus. Most of the worlds phosphorus is used to grow food to feed to animals to produce meat. Manure isnt returned to growing regions, and instead leads to algal blooms and nutrient pollution. Were fixing this problem with tech to produce fertilizer from manure, helping farmers grow better food at a price farmers can afford.

StratComm, Inc.

People always ask, what does strategic communications mean? For us, it means finding interesting, smart, and inventive ways to get information to the right people. It means streamlining programs that are cumbersome, messy, and confusing and making them easy to use. It means identifying dated layout and design and creating content that is stunning and engaging. Based in Natick, MA, Strategic Communications, Inc. (StratComm) has served the marketing, communications, training, and project management needs of nationwide Fortune 500 companies, many federal agencies, and all branches of the Armed Forces for over 45 years. Our team works with a variety of clients and delivers an array of services. We create high-quality publications, both print and electronic, and training platforms for leading corporations and organizations such as IBM, VMware, the United States Navy and Air Force, the U.S. Department of State, Veterans Affairs, the U.S. Treasury, and many other important agencies and organizations. We also manage large programs for the federal government utilizing emerging technologies. Two examples are online training and testing programs for U.S. Embassies worldwide and program management for the Social Security Administration. Many high profile clients contract with StratComm to update the design and content of their websites, brochures, annual reports, and web apps. Our team is constantly seeking newer technologies and developing efficiencies to better serve our clients.
